AceEditor compiles with JSHint, but it should be possible to switch this out for ESLint using something like https://www.npmjs.com/package/eslint4b
Description
Details
Subject | Repo | Branch | Lines +/- | |
---|---|---|---|---|
Rebuild Ace Editor to use ESLint instead of JSHint | mediawiki/extensions/CodeEditor | master | +43 -13 K |
Status | Subtype | Assigned | Task | ||
---|---|---|---|---|---|
Resolved | None | T118941 Switch to eslint for our linting and our code styling in all Wikimedia JavaScript code | |||
Open | None | T250315 Use ESLint in CodeEditor, instead of JSHint |
Event Timeline
Change 589105 had a related patch set uploaded (by Esanders; owner: Esanders):
[mediawiki/extensions/CodeEditor@master] Rebuild Ace Editor to use ESLint instead of JSHint
@Esanders: Removing task assignee as this open task has been assigned for more than two years - See the email sent to task assignee on Feburary 22nd, 2023.
Please assign this task to yourself again if you still realistically [plan to] work on this task - it would be welcome! :)
If this task has been resolved in the meantime, or should not be worked on by anybody ("declined"), please update its task status via "Add Action… 🡒 Change Status".
Also see https://www.mediawiki.org/wiki/Bug_management/Assignee_cleanup for tips how to best manage your individual work in Phabricator. Thanks!